09. Haven't seen the movie, but I wouldn't quite consider the book a "lame remake" of 1984. It's a genre, and they're all similar--but that doesn't constitute a remake or ripoff. I'm going to do some assuming here, and assume that 1984 is the only dystopic novel that you've read? Because you'll find similar themes in "Brave New World", "Fahrenheit 451", "Anthem", and so on. And 1984 wasn't even the first book in that genre--Orwell himself admits getting the idea from "We" by Yevgeny Zamyatin.
